DOJ No. 2, David W. Ogden, steps down
Politico ^ | 12-3-09 | Nia-Malika Henderson

Posted on 12/03/2009 10:00:41 AM PST by STARWISE

The second-in-command at the Justice Department is leaving his post, officials announced Thursday — making him the third top Obama legal official to announce his departure in recent weeks.

Deputy Attorney General David W. Ogden will return to private practice in February. White House General Counsel Greg Craig will step down in January, and Phillip Carter, a top Defense Department deputy assistant secretary dealing with detainee issues, has already left.

Ogden, who managed the civil division during the Clinton administration, headed up President Barack Obama’s transition into office last year.

In a statement, Ogden said that his tenure in the administration was always meant to be temporary.

“I took a leave from my practice of law thirteen months ago on Election Day to lead the Department of Justice transition for President Obama.

My hope then was to identify the goals for a successful transition at a critical time for the Department, when its credibility was under attack and when its traditional law enforcement missions had suffered,” he said in a statement.

“During the transition, President-elect Obama and Attorney General-designate Holder asked me to serve as the Deputy Attorney General, which gave me the opportunity to complete the transition process and see the Department solidly on a path to achieving those goals.”

Deputy assistant attorney general Gary Grindler will step in for Ogden on an interim basis, according to the Washington Post.

Craig came under fire for his handling of the closing of Guantanamo Bay military prison, though Craig has denied that was the reason for leaving, saying he always expected to return to private practice.

Carter announced he was leaving his job last month for personal reasons, after taking the detainee job in May 2009.
